Output 5594cb00ea0339fedf9875ffb845e8e3176b752fffb837df5c8e293800e4235a:3

value
12029190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a58144cd5f49db118ecb2ba36e22b4b3d47256 OP_EQUAL
address
37VYm7dBDBoSp5xxBzwCjTAMBgCMcjwx2b
transaction
5594cb00ea0339fedf9875ffb845e8e3176b752fffb837df5c8e293800e4235a
spent
true